About DLSC0000086 IFSC Code

The IFSC code DLSC0000086 belongs to The Delhi State Cooperative Bank's MAANDI branch. The first 4 characters 'DLSC' identify The Delhi State Cooperative Bank, the 5th character '0' is reserved for future use, and the last 6 characters '000086' uniquely identify this particular branch.

Banking Terms Glossary

What is an IFSC Code?

Indian Financial System Code (IFSC) is an 11-digit alphanumeric code that uniquely identifies a bank branch participating in any RBI regulated funds transfer system. It is mandatory for electronic payment applications like NEFT, RTGS, and IMPS.

What is a MICR Code?

Magnetic Ink Character Recognition (MICR) is a 9-digit code printed on cheque books. It facilitates the processing and clearance of cheques and helps prevent fraud. The first 3 digits represent the city, the next 3 represent the bank, and the last 3 represent the branch.

What is NEFT?

National Electronic Funds Transfer (NEFT) is a nationwide payment system facilitating one-to-one funds transfer. Under this scheme, individuals can electronically transfer funds from any bank branch to any individual having an account with any other bank branch in the country participating in the Scheme.

What is RTGS?

Real Time Gross Settlement (RTGS) is a system where there is continuous and real-time settlement of fund-transfers, individually on a transaction by transaction basis. It is primarily meant for large value transactions. The minimum amount to be remitted through RTGS is ₹2,00,000.

What is IMPS?

Immediate Payment Service (IMPS) is an instant payment inter-bank electronic funds transfer system in India. IMPS offers an inter-bank electronic fund transfer service through mobile phones and internet banking, available 24x7 throughout the year including bank holidays.

What is UPI?

Unified Payments Interface (UPI) is a system that powers multiple bank accounts into a single mobile application (of any participating bank), merging several banking features, seamless fund routing & merchant payments into one hood. It also caters to the 'Peer to Peer' collect request.
